Monster Trucks Movie Set for 2017 Release

Monster truck fans, get ready! The big, crazy, gas-guzzling, dirt-slinging, show-stealing performance rides you love are set to hit the big screen in January 2017 in a comedy/action/animation film titled, appropriately, Monster Truck.

Thus far, not much is known about the film except for its IMDB.com-listed cast and synopsis:

“Looking for any way to get away from the life and town he was born into, Tripp (Lucas Till), a high school senior, builds a Monster Truck from bits and pieces of scrapped cars. After an accident at a nearby oil-drilling site displaces a strange and subterranean creature with a taste and a talent for speed, Tripp may have just found the key to getting out of town and a most unlikely friend.”

The cast includes Till, known for his role as Havoc in the X-Men film franchise; Amy Ryan, who you’ll remember as Holly Flax in the NBC comedy, The Office; up-and-comer Jane Levy; and big screen veterans Rob Lowe and Danny Glover. The movie is being filmed in Canada and is set for a January 13 release.
